Consulting Development Program applicants have rated the interview process at UnitedHealth Group with 2.9 out of 5 (where 5 is the highest level of difficulty) and assessed their interview experience as 60% positive. To compare, the company-average is 60% positive. This is according to Glassdoor user ratings.
Candidates applying for Consulting Development Program roles take an average of 35 days to get hired, when considering 10 user submitted interviews for this role. To compare, the hiring process at UnitedHealth Group overall takes an average of 25 days.
Common stages of the interview process at UnitedHealth Group as a Consulting Development Program according to 10 Glassdoor interviews include:
One on one interview: 60%
Group panel interview: 20%
Phone interview: 20%

I applied through college or university. The process took 4 weeks. I interviewed at UnitedHealth Group (Eden Prairie, MN) in Nov 2018
Interview
Applied through college's career portal, interviewed on-campus a week later, then invited to an on-site interview a week after that. First on-campus interview was 30 minutes and relatively standard, although the interviewer was hard to read. On-site included a tour of the HQ campus, two 30-minute interviews, and a 30-minute Q&A with two current consultants. Questions were largely behavioral with only a 5-minute "case-style" question that wasn't too hard.
Optum seems to be looking for a certain type of person that fits their very Minnesota mold, although everyone seemed extroverted and friendly. That said, Optum's CDP seemed very third-tier and not up to the standards of well-established consulting firms and most of their projects seemed to be internal. I fail to see how such a short interview process would lead to the selection of the best consultants rather than selecting people of a similar personality type from the same group of regional schools they recruit from.
Interview questions [1]
Question 1
Why Optum? What skills align with the role? What is your communication style? What is your greatest achievement? Can you review your resume? How would you determine the number of flights at an airport in a year (mini-case)? Other general behavioral questions...

Applied online through university career website; had an on campus interview, and then an onsite interview with 2 different employees. On campus was fairly easy, interviewer was very nice.
Interview questions [1]
Question 1
How would you go about calculating the amount of departures from Newark Airport?

Applied through university recruiting, sent a virtual cover letter, interviewed onsite (3 separate interviews, but the same questions every time), and heard back a few days later. The whole process took about a month.
